WATERBURY, Conn., June 25, 2008 /PRNewswire-FirstCall via COMTEX News Network/ -- HSA Bank®, a
division of Webster Bank, N.A., a subsidiary of Webster Financial Corporation
(NYSE: WBS), announced today that it has formed an integrated relationship
with Health Care Service Corporation (HCSC), the fourth largest health insurer
in the country. The integrated relationship allows accountholders to access
health plan and HSA information quicker, easier and from one primary point of
contact.
We saw HSA Bank as being a strong partner that would complement our
existing partnerships supporting our 'plug and play' approach, said Kirk
Pion, the executive director of the Consumerism Program at HCSC. Our
customers demand integration partner options and flexible product offerings
that are easy to use and promote the responsibility that consumer-driven
health products were designed to achieve.
The integration strategy creates one primary source for customer service
support, a single website to view health plan claims and HSA transactions and
efficient enrollment processes based on an employer's needs. The relationship
between HSA Bank and HCSC utilizes a secure web service to provide real-time
account information, which plugs into HCSC's member portal infrastructure.
While consumer-driven health care is an attractive product offering, it
can create a segmented customer experience between the high deductible health
plan and the health savings account (HSA), said Kirk Hoewisch, president of
HSA Bank. The integration strategy employed by HSA Bank and HCSC creates a
more seamless customer experience by providing members with a single
point-of-contact for information regarding their health plan and HSA
information.

Webster Financial Corporation is the holding company for Webster Bank,
National Association. With $17.2 billion in assets, Webster provides business
and consumer banking, mortgage, financial planning, trust and investment
services through 181 banking offices, 484 ATMs, telephone banking and the
Internet. Webster Bank owns the asset-based lending firm Webster Business
Credit Corporation, the insurance premium finance company Budget Installment
Corp., Center Capital Corporation, an equipment finance company headquartered
in Farmington, Connecticut and provides health savings account trustee and
administrative services through HSA Bank, a division of Webster Bank. Member
FDIC and equal housing lender.
